Gender Identity Disorder
A clinical term previously used to denote severe discomfort or distress due to a disparity between a person's physical or assigned gender and the gender with which they identify, now more commonly referred to as gender dysphoria.
Theoretical Orientation
An underlying theory or perspective that guides a professional's approach to treatment in fields such as psychology or counseling.
Sociocultural
Pertaining to the influence that society and culture have on beliefs, behaviors, and emotions, focusing on how people are affected by and interact with societal norms, values, and practices.
Gender Dysphoria
A psychological condition where there is a significant discrepancy between an individual’s assigned sex at birth and their experienced or expressed gender, often leading to distress.
